Types of Links and Their Impact

There are different types of links that impact a website’s SEO efforts, including internal links, external links (backlinks), and different attributes like nofollow and dofollow links.

Internal Links

Internal links are hyperlinks that point from one page on a domain to another page on the same domain. These links are essential for website navigation and SEO optimization.

External Links (Backlinks)

External links, also known as backlinks, are links from other websites to your site. Backlinks are crucial for SEO as they act as signals of trust and authority to search engines. High-quality backlinks from reputable sources can significantly impact a site’s search engine rankings.

Nofollow and Dofollow Links

Nofollow and dofollow are link attributes that determine how search engines should treat a link. Nofollow links instruct search engines not to pass any SEO value to the linked page, while dofollow links do pass SEO value. Understanding and utilizing these attributes strategically can influence a site’s link equity and search engine visibility.

Essential Link Building Techniques

Effective link building strategies involve various techniques such as content marketing, outreach, guest posting, and broken link building.

Content Marketing

Content marketing focuses on creating valuable and shareable content that naturally attracts links from other websites. By producing high-quality content, a website can increase its chances of earning backlinks from authoritative sources.

Outreach

Outreach involves identifying relevant websites and influencers within a specific niche and building relationships with them to secure backlinks through guest posting, interviews, and collaborative content efforts. Establishing connections within the industry can lead to valuable link opportunities.

Guest Posting

Guest posting is a strategy where a website contributes high-quality articles to other websites in exchange for a backlink. This technique not only helps in acquiring backlinks but also aids in building brand awareness and establishing credibility within the industry. Broken Link Building

Broken link building entails finding websites with broken links that point to non-existent pages and offering valuable content as a replacement. By fixing broken links on other sites, a website can earn new backlinks and improve its own link profile.

Evaluating Link Building Strategies

It is essential to monitor and evaluate link building strategies to ensure their effectiveness and impact on SEO performance.

Monitoring Link Metrics

Key metrics such as total backlinks, referring domains, and anchor text distribution should be tracked to evaluate the success of a link building campaign. Utilizing tools to analyze backlink quality can help identify areas for improvement and optimization.

Link Building Best Practices

Adhering to best practices in link building involves focusing on acquiring natural and relevant backlinks. Avoiding black hat techniques or paid links is crucial to maintaining a website’s credibility. Prioritizing quality over quantity and monitoring and disavowing spammy or low-quality backlinks are also key practices to follow. Advanced Link Building Tactics

Advanced Link Building Tactics

Advanced link building tactics include influencer marketing, link reclaiming, and resource link building.

Influencer Marketing

Influencer marketing involves collaborating with influencers in a particular industry to promote content and gain backlinks. Leveraging social media, email marketing, and guest blogging can help reach influencers and secure valuable backlinks. Link Reclaiming

Link reclaiming focuses on identifying unlinked mentions of a brand or website online and requesting backlinks to those mentions. This tactic helps in recovering lost backlinks and improving overall brand visibility on the web. Resource Link Building

Resource link building revolves around creating valuable resources such as whitepapers and infographics that other websites would want to link to. By providing useful information and building trust with other sites, a website can attract organic backlinks from diverse sources. Frequently Asked Questions

1. What is link building?

Link building is the process of acquiring hyperlinks from other websites to your own. These hyperlinks improve your site’s authority and credibility in the eyes of search engines.

2. Why is link building important for SEO?

Link building is important for SEO because search engines like Google use backlinks as a key ranking factor. The more quality backlinks you have, the higher your website is likely to rank in search results.

3. What are some effective link building strategies for beginners?

Some effective link building strategies for beginners include guest blogging, creating high-quality content that others want to link to, reaching out to industry influencers for partnerships, and participating in relevant online communities and forums.

4. How can I assess the quality of backlinks for link building?

You can assess the quality of backlinks by looking at factors such as the domain authority of the linking site, relevance of the linking site to your own, the anchor text used in the link, and the context in which the link appears.

5. How long does it take to see the results of link building efforts?

The timeline for seeing results from link building efforts can vary depending on factors such as the competitiveness of your industry, the quality of the links you’re building, and the authority of your website.
